Bergey’s Manual of Systematics of Archaea and Bacteria differs from Bergey’s Manual of Determinative Bacteriology in that the former
groups bacteria according to phylogenetic relationships.
Bacillus and Lactobacillus are not in the same order. This indicates that which one of the following is not sufficient to assign an organism to a taxon?
Morphological characteristics
Which of the following is used to classify organisms into the Kingdom Fungi?
absorptive; possess cell wall; eukaryotic
Which of the following is false about scientific nomenclature?
Names vary with geographical location.
You could identify an unknown bacterium by all of the following except
percentage of guanine + cytosine.
The wall-less mycoplasmas are considered to be related to gram-positive bacteria. Which of the following would provide the most compelling evidence for this?
They share common rRNA sequences.
Into which group would you place a multicellular organism that has a mouth and lives inside the human liver?
a.Animalia
Into which group would you place a photosynthetic organism that lacks a nucleus and has a thin peptidoglycan wall surrounded by an outer membrane?
e. Pseudomonadota (gram-negative bacteria)
